Tempo is a German brand of paper tissues introduced in 1929 by the Vereinigte Papierwerke AG. The brand is renowned for its soft and strong tissues, which are also machine washable and biodegradable. In 1999, Essity, a Swedish hygiene and health company, acquired the brand. Essity is headquartered in Sweden and operates globally, offering a wide range of personal care and hygiene products. Tempo tissues are primarily manufactured in Germany, with production also taking place in other locations. The brand's commitment to sustainability is evident through its use of responsibly sourced fibers and recyclable packaging. (de.wikipedia.org)
